To provide high-quality care, learning, and development opportunities for children aged 0–5 years in accordance with the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ework. The Nursery Practitioner will create a safe, stimulating, and inclusive environment that supports children's emotional, social, physical, and intellectual development.
Key Responsibilities Childcare and Education
- Plan and deliver age-appropriate activities in line with EYFS requirements.
- Support children's learning and development through play-based experiences.
- Observe, assess, and record children's progress.
- Act as a key person for a group of children and maintain positive relationships with families.
Safeguarding and Welfare
- Ensure children's safety and wellbeing at all times.
- Follow nursery safeguarding, health and safety, and child protection policies.
- Report any concerns regarding a child's welfare in line with safeguarding procedures.
Parent and Carer Partnerships
- Build positive relationships with parents and carers.
- Provide regular updates on children's development and wellbeing.
- Attend parent meetings and nursery events when required.
Teamwork
- Work collaboratively with colleagues and management.
- Attend staff meetings, training sessions, and professional development activities.
- Contribute to maintaining a positive and professional nursery environment.
General Duties
- Maintain a clean, safe, and stimulating learning environment.
- Assist with meal times, personal care, and daily routines.
- Support inclusion and equality for all children and families.
Essential Requirements
- Level 2 or Level 3 qualification in Early Years Childcare (or equivalent recognised UK qualification).
- Sound knowledge of the EYFS framework.
- Understanding of safeguarding and child protection procedures.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to work effectively as part of a team.
Desirable Requirements
- Paediatric First Aid qualification.
- Knowledge of special educational needs and disabilities (SEND).
